On Wed, 2006-06-28 at 13:02 +0200, Brian Durant wrote:

I have tried using the above method, but actually can't see how this
should work as there doesn't seem to be a way of loading the CD
drivers before the SATA driver. A loop develops with the selection of
the CD drivers, because the SATA drivers have already loaded and the
CD-ROM still cannot be detected, despite only choosing the above
quoted CD drivers. Can someone walk me through this, please?

For those of you that don't understand why I don't just install Etch
beta 2, I can say that I have tried that. There is an issue with Etch
not being able to detect USB keyboards (and maybe mice as well)
during the install. This isn't in the errata and I would consider it
a bug. However, as I don't want to run a 'testing" system anyway, it
is just another reason to get a Sarge install to work.

The CD on this machine shouldn't be on the SATA controller... it's
supposed to be on the good'old Apple PowerMac IDE controller. I haven't
seen any kind of conflict so far with those...
